Research in her group has continued to unravel the molecular mechanisms that enable plants to adapt to mineral nutrient deficiency, salinity and drought. Current projects investigate the genetic and epigenetic determinants of plant stress tolerance and of root architectural changes under mineral nutrient deficiency. Collaboration with bio-informaticians, computer scientists and software developers has resulted in popular analysis pipelines for large ‘omics’ dataset as well as biometric software for large-scale phenotyping. In collaboration with engineers, the group applies microfluidics technology in synthetic biology and marine bioprospecting projects. Anna has established a substantial portfolio of collaborative work with industrial partners based on the use of cyanobacteria as a chassis for the production of polymers, pigments and photo-switches.
